1979 static char *usage_msg[] = {
1980 "-0[octal] specify record separator (\\0, if no argument)",
1981 "-a autosplit mode with -n or -p (splits $_ into @F)",
1982 "-C enable native wide character system interfaces",
1983 "-c check syntax only (runs BEGIN and CHECK blocks)",
1984 "-d[:debugger] run program under debugger",
1985 "-D[number/list] set debugging flags (argument is a bit mask or alphabets)",
1986 "-e 'command' one line of program (several -e's allowed, omit programfile)",
1987 "-F/pattern/ split() pattern for -a switch (//'s are optional)",
1988 "-i[extension] edit <> files in place (makes backup if extension supplied)",
1989 "-Idirectory specify @INC/#include directory (several -I's allowed)",
1990 "-l[octal] enable line ending processing, specifies line terminator",
1991 "-[mM][-]module execute `use/no module...' before executing program",
1992 "-n assume 'while (<>) { ... }' loop around program",
1993 "-p assume loop like -n but print line also, like sed",
1994 "-P run program through C preprocessor before compilation",
1995 "-s enable rudimentary parsing for switches after programfile",
1996 "-S look for programfile using PATH environment variable",
1997 "-T enable tainting checks",
1998 "-u dump core after parsing program",
1999 "-U allow unsafe operations",
2000 "-v print version, subversion (includes VERY IMPORTANT perl info)",
2001 "-V[:variable] print configuration summary (or a single Config.pm variable)",
2002 "-w enable many useful warnings (RECOMMENDED)",
2003 "-W enable all warnings",
2004 "-X disable all warnings",
2005 "-x[directory] strip off text before #!perl line and perhaps cd to directory",

2780 /* do we need to emulate setuid on scripts? */
2782 /* This code is for those BSD systems that have setuid #! scripts disabled
2783 * in the kernel because of a security problem. Merely defining DOSUID
2784 * in perl will not fix that problem, but if you have disabled setuid
2785 * scripts in the kernel, this will attempt to emulate setuid and setgid
2786 * on scripts that have those now-otherwise-useless bits set. The setuid
2787 * root version must be called suidperl or sperlN.NNN. If regular perl
2788 * discovers that it has opened a setuid script, it calls suidperl with
2789 * the same argv that it had. If suidperl finds that the script it has
2790 * just opened is NOT setuid root, it sets the effective uid back to the
2791 * uid. We don't just make perl setuid root because that loses the
2792 * effective uid we had before invoking perl, if it was different from the
2795 * DOSUID must be defined in both perl and suidperl, and IAMSUID must
2796 * be defined in suidperl only. suidperl must be setuid root. The
2797 * Configure script will set this up for you if you want it.
